Abstract

The invention relates to a terminal block for the electrical connection of electric power supply cables, comprising at least one electrical conductor having a high mechanical strength, especially for the supply of consumer (user) devices. This terminal block is of the type in which a connection device (2) is mounted between the two pre-stripped ends of the conductors (a, b). It is characterised in that each connection device (2) comprises at least two connection terminals (4, 5), each of which is connected to one of the conductor ends (a, b) and which are electrically connected together by a means (15) permitting relative displacement of one terminal with respect to the other. The invention can be used for public lighting lamp posts. <IMAGE>
